Orchestra Long Island (OLI), in partnership with Nassau Board of Cooperative Educational Services (BOCES) and Nassau County school districts, presents a Student Mentorship/in-School Performance and Instructional Program called Performance Partners.
The program consists of OLI musicians instructing, coaching and mentoring students in a series of workshops, plus a conductor’s rehearsal and a dress rehearsal with the professional musicians, culminating in a public side-by- side concert led by a professional conductor. This program currently take place in The Wheatley School and Uniondale High School. This life-changing orchestra collaboration has brought national attention, receiving a Yale Distinguished Music Educator Award in 2015. Originally conceived as a partnership between Nassau BOCES and the Brooklyn Philharmonic in 1986, the program's orchestral leadership, guided by Nassau BOCES, eventually moved to the New York Virtuosi and then to the Long Island Philharmonic under the direction of Maestro Wiley. When the former LI Philharmonic ceased operation in 2016, the musicians and Maestro Wiley, deeply committed to the program, found a temporary home with the Bronx Arts Ensemble until OLI’s founding.
